The Art of Uniform: Thom Browne’s Subversive Tailoring
Origins and Founding
Thom Browne launched his namesake label in 2001, beginning with a made-to-measure shop in New York City’s West Village. Starting with five meticulously crafted grey suits, he reimagined classic American tailoring through a lens of conceptual minimalism and precise proportion. His first ready-to-wear menswear collection debuted in 2003, marking the start of a brand that would redefine modern suiting.
Ownership and Leadership
Thom Browne serves as the founder and creative director of his eponymous brand. In 2018, the Italian luxury group Zegna acquired an 85% stake in the company, with Browne retaining the remaining 15%. Under his leadership, the brand has expanded globally, offering menswear, womenswear, accessories, and childrenswear, all while maintaining its distinct aesthetic.
Aesthetic and Design Language
Thom Browne’s aesthetic is characterized by shrunken silhouettes, cropped trousers, and a palette dominated by shades of grey. His designs often incorporate elements of traditional school uniforms and classic American sportswear, reinterpreted with a modern, avant-garde twist. Signature details include the use of grosgrain ribbon trims and the iconic four-bar stripe motif. Browne’s runway presentations are known for their theatricality and conceptual narratives, blurring the lines between fashion and performance art.
Notable Pieces
- Cropped Grey Suit – A modern take on the classic suit, featuring a shortened jacket and trousers that hit above the ankle.
- Four-Bar Stripe Cardigan – A knitwear staple adorned with the brand’s signature stripe on the sleeve.
- Grosgrain-Trimmed Oxford Shirt – A crisp white shirt accented with tricolor ribbon detailing.
- Pleated Skirt for Men – A gender-defying piece that challenges traditional menswear norms.
- Dachshund-Shaped Handbag – A whimsical accessory inspired by Browne’s pet dog, Hector.
